Police Chief of Criminal Investigations, Deputy Commissioner Seelall Persaud said investigators have learnt that about one month ago a man had called the dead man's wife, demanding a vehicle or money and made threatening remarks. Persaud was not in a position to say what was the nature of the threat. The body of 25-year old Shawn De Freitas Sukhdeo of Mon Repos, East Coast Demerara was discovered shortly after 6 O’clock Tuesday morning. It bore several gunshot wounds and burnt marks. So far investigators have learnt that the man had owed amounts of GUY$500,000 and G UY$300,000. It is unclear how many more persons he had owed.
